Oral Hygiene Systems and Methods
A method for promoting compliance with an oral hygiene regimen includes displaying, on a display device, a representation of at least a portion of a set of teeth of a user. The method also includes overlaying an indicium on the representation such that the indicium is associated with a first section of the representation. Responsive to a determination, via at least one of one or more processors, that a head of an oral hygiene device is positioned directly adjacent to a first section of the set of teeth that corresponds to the first section of the representation for at least a predetermined amount of time, the indicium is removed from the display device.
Oral care mouthpiece with brushing elements
This disclosure relates to oral care mouthpieces and methods of forming oral care mouthpieces. A disclosed oral care mouthpiece includes a base shaped to a dental arch. The base elastically deforms in response to pressure variations in the mouthpiece. The mouthpiece also includes a set of one or more supports attached to the base and placed to allow the base to elastically deform in response to the pressure variations in the mouthpiece. The mouthpiece also includes a set of oral care elements attached to the set of one or more supports and placed to transmit pressure to the dental arch when the base elastically deforms in response to the pressure variations in the mouthpiece.
Oral hygiene device
Systems and methods are generally described for an oral hygiene device. The oral hygiene device may include a handle portion and a head portion coupled to the handle portion and including a pick head interface. A pick head may be removably coupled to the pick head interface. The pick head may include a pointed pick member. An image capture device may be disposed in the head portion. The image capture device may be effective to capture image data representing images of an area proximal to a tip of the pointed pick member. A vibration element may be coupled to the pick head interface. The vibration element may be effective to vibrate the pick head.
System and Method for Assessing Toothbrush Effectiveness
In one embodiment, the invention can be a system for determining toothbrush effectiveness, the system comprising a data capture subsystem comprising at least one sensor and configured to generate brushing data during a participant brushing session directed entirely by the participant, and at least one processor configured to receive the brushing data from the data capture subsystem. A brushing simulation subsystem includes artificial teeth; and a robotic arm configured to: hold a toothbrush; and receive from the at least one processor instructions for a motion to be carried out by the robotic arm, the motion of the robotic arm causing the toothbrush to carry out an automated brushing session upon the artificial teeth, the motion of the robotic arm being based on the brushing data captured during the participant brushing session.
Method for determining of movement patterns during a dental treatment
An electric toothbrush includes a brush head at an end of a handle, an acceleration sensor and/or a rotation sensor that detect(s) movement parameters of the electric toothbrush, a wireless communication interface that wirelessly transmits recorded data comprising the detected movements parameters of the electric toothbrush in a processed state and receives treatment mode data for operating the electric toothbrush, a pressure sensor that detects a contact pressure applied by the brush head to teeth and/or gums, at least one first outputting device that visually outputs signals or commands in accordance with the detected contact pressure or in accordance with the detected movement parameters, and at least one second outputting device that haptically outputs signals or commands, in the form of vibrations, in accordance with the detected contact pressure or in accordance with the detected movement parameters.

Oral care system and method
In one embodiment, an oral care system may include a toothbrush comprising a physical property, and a programmable processor configured to receive physical property data indicative of the physical property of the toothbrush. The programmable processor may be further configured to determine, based at least in part upon the received physical property data, a suggested brushing routine for a user and/or an evaluation of a brushing session of a user.
Methods and systems for extracting brushing motion characteristics of a user using an oral hygiene device including at least one accelerometer to provide feedback to a user
Systems and methods for enhancing a user's efficiency while operating an oral hygiene device (10) is provided. In an exemplary embodiment, motion information of an oral hygiene device is received from one or more accelerometers (32) located within the oral hygiene device. The received motion information is compared to a targeted motion of the oral hygiene device. The user operating the oral hygiene device is then provided with feedback in response to determining that the received motion information is within a predefined range of the targeted motion information.
System and method for determining and notifying a user when to replace a dental cleaning head
A system and method of determining and notifying a user when to replace a worn dental cleaning head (104), comprises receiving, from a sensor (106), at least one measured value; calculating, using the measured value, a burn metric of the dental cleaning head; modeling, using the burn metric, an estimated lifetime of the dental cleaning head; determining, from the lifetime model, whether the dental cleaning head is in need of replacement; and notifying the user upon determining that the dental cleaning head is in need of replacement.
Electric toothbrush with assembly for detecting pressure against brush head
Disclosed is an electric toothbrush, comprising: a handle; a drive element provided in the handle, an output shaft of the drive element extending out of the handle; a brush head disposed at one end of the output shaft remote from the handle and connected to the output shaft; and a stress triggering element and a stress detecting element, which are oppositely provided on surfaces of the output shaft; wherein the stress triggering element is configured for producing stress concentration at the position where the stress triggering element is located when the output shaft motions; and the stress detecting element is configured for detecting the stress at the position where the stress triggering element is located, thereby obtaining a pressure corresponding to the stress, the electric toothbrush as provided offers a simple structure for pressure detection.
